A heartbreaking incident unfolded in Cincinnati, leaving five children injured, an 11-year-old boy tragically dead after a senseless shooting in the city’s West End.

On a somber Friday night, just before 9:30 p.m., an unknown gunman opened fire in a drive-by shooting, firing an alarming 22 rounds from a dark sedan into a crowd of children and adults. The victims of this horrifying act included an 11-year-old boy, whose young life was cut short in a moment of senseless violence. Three other boys, aged between 12 and 15, and a 15-year-old girl were also struck, along with a 53-year-old woman.

The 11-year-old victim, whose identity has been confirmed as Dominic Davis, succumbed to his injuries, leaving a community in mourning and shock. Police Chief Terri Theetge told reporters Sunday that an occupant of a sedan fired 22 rounds “in quick succession” into a crowd of children just before 9:30 p.m. Friday on the city’s West End. A 53-year-old woman was hit along with the boy who died, three other boys and a 15-year-old girl.

Local authorities are actively investigating the shooting, working tirelessly to identify and apprehend the individual responsible for this heinous act. The injured victims are receiving medical care, with one remaining hospitalized in stable condition.
